Output 19fec5c3eaf7446deba4229f69783115ac336afb07f310e6da5fa7a591af9184:20

value
706364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b91946027619d256e8275fde02f95a32afcb39b OP_EQUAL
address
3A3Bp3imeR7Favj9pmvisKDU7JydFkmNko
transaction
19fec5c3eaf7446deba4229f69783115ac336afb07f310e6da5fa7a591af9184